Mumford & Sons Match Grandeur of Red Rocks on ‘I Will Wait’
In their new video for “I Will Wait,” Mumford & Sons get the cinematic treatment at Colorado’s storied Rock Rocks Amphitheatre. Behind the backdrop of the beautiful venue and a sea of enthusiastic fans, the folk band deliver their latest single with epic energy. Panoramic shots wash over the audience and the band, but despite the grandiose affair, the track feels warm, intimate and sincere.
“We’re really excited to broaden that spectrum of people’s perception of what we are musically,” Ted Dwane told Rolling Stone last month regarding the new album, Babel. “I think the most exciting thing that is different is just having done some live recordings. We really call ourselves a live band, and it was really important to us to start really exploring that way of recording.”
“I Will Wait” is the first single off Babel, out September 21st.
